PARENTS: Luther Clark, born Hopkinton, Middlesex Co., MA., and Sally Walker, born Uxbridge, Worcester Co., MA.

MARRIAGE: Married Eliza Mundell, SEP 18, 1836, at Westminster, Windham Co., VT.

DAUGHTER: Eliza Angeline Clark, wife of Samuel C. Sherman.

DAUGHTER: Hannah Elizabeth Clark, wife of William J.G. Mundell, and later Francis "Frank" Noyes Sherman.

OCCUPATION: Farmer

RESIDENCE: Hubbardston, Leominster, Rutland, Worcester Co., MA.

GOOSE HILL CEMETERY: My grandmother took me to this unmarked cemetery, in Rutland, Worcester Co., MA. She called it Gooseneck Cemetery, but I believe it is now called "Goose Hill" Cemetery. Grandmother showed me a spot at the very back corner of the cemetery where Luther and his wife Eliza are buried. There are several illegible headstones in this area, but we do not know if they had a headstone or not.

CEMETERY LOCATION: It is on a steep embankment on the northwest side of the road. It shows on the Rutland, MA map as being on Charnock Rd, which runs northerly from Rte. 68 in North Rutland. At this point, across Rte. 68 is another road called River Road, actually a continuation of Intervale Rd." I took a picture of a house across the street near the cemetery to use as a landmark in case I needed to find it again. It was a two story house, that was yellow, and the address on the mailbox was #244.
